		<description>The Palm Beach Post runs Doonesbury, For Better or for Worse and Peanuts. While it hasn&#039;t replaced any of those, it has added The Pajama Diaries. I&#039;m surprised the papers that dumped Doonesbury haven&#039;t quit the others (Peanuts is on permanent vacation, and who knows when Better or Worse will get off its Jekyll or Hyde jag of old or new).

It&#039;s hip for newspapers to buy syndicated editorial cartoons instead of hiring their own (the way radio stations would rather buy the services of a cheap voice-tracker like Delilah instead of paying extra for a local). I hope papers don&#039;t extend the idea to the funny papers. I watched my old paper give up its old Sunday magazine in favor of the syndicated Parade. Do we want the Parade company to supply papers with the Sunday funnies?</description>
